Responsibilities

  • Perform electro‑mechanical assembly of robotic system modules including joints, control modules, and cable harnesses by following detailed work instructions and engineering documentation.
  • Operate within a structured production line environment to meet daily build targets while maintaining compliance with ISO 13485, FDA QSR, and Good Documentation Practices (GDP).
  • Interpret and apply defined assembly procedures to correctly build, verify, and validate mechanical and electromechanical components.
  • Conduct basic functional, electrical, and mechanical tests using calibrated tools, test fixtures, torque equipment, and multimeters.
  • Identify and escalate assembly, component, or test issues to senior technicians or engineering in a timely manner.
  • Follow clean manufacturing, ESD protection, and contamination control requirements for regulated medical device assembly.
  • Accurately record build steps, inspection results, and test outcomes in MES, ERP/SAP, and electronic DHR systems.
  • Participate in in‑process inspections and quality verifications to ensure work aligns with workmanship and quality standards.
  • Maintain clean and organized work areas in accordance with safety, quality, and 6S standards.
  • Support manufacturing engineering during line setup, process clarifications, or simple troubleshooting tasks as assigned.
  • Maintain certification and demonstrate proficiency on at least one designated module while meeting all safety, quality, and training requirements.

Learn more at https://www.jnj.com/medtech We are searching for the best talent for Manufacturing Tech I, in support of the OTTAVA Surgical Robotic Platform. The Manufacturing Technician I is responsible for performing electro-mechanical assembly of robotic modules and components, supporting production schedules, and maintaining compliance with medical device regulations. This role reports into the Surgical Robotics (OTTAVA™) Manufacturing organization. We are seeking a detail-oriented individual who thrives in a fast-paced environment and is eager to learn and grow. This position offers hands-on experience with innovative technology and opportunities for long-term career development.
